The job itself
Beverley Town Council is looking for an Assistant Town Clerk to join our small, dedicated team supporting 14 elected members. This part-time role (25 hours/week) is mainly Monday to Friday, but flexibility is essential to attend approximately two evening meetings per month and 3 to 6 community events per year, some of which take place in the evenings or at weekends.
You will assist the Town Clerk in a wide range of duties to ensure the smooth running of the Town Council. This includes managing the Civic Diary in coordination with the Mayor and liaising with external organisations on invitations and correspondence. You will assist with Council and committee meetings, preparing agendas, supporting documents, and taking accurate minutes, as well as helping to follow up resolutions and assist with the successful delivery of project and events.
A key part of your role will be overseeing the Council’s allotments, acting as the main contact for tenants, responding to queries, carrying out weekly site inspections, and helping resolve issues or disputes. You will also contribute to the town’s wider community services, supporting initiatives such as floral displays, street lighting, Christmas lights and other civic or community projects. You will act as cover for the Town Clerk and the Responsible Financial Officer during periods of annual leave or illness.
This role requires organisation, adaptability and a hands-on approach. The successful candidate will be required to undertake professional development opportunities, including accredited courses, one-off training events, are actively encouraged and in-house training to support them in fulfilling their duties effectively.
